Senpai Daniel Omoto, 3rd Dan Black Belt
Senpai Daniel began his karate training in 1985 in Newbury Park, CA under Sensei Alex Schein.  Later, Sensei Marcus Young (Sensei Victor Young’s son) took over the teaching position in Newbury Park, and eventually transferred all the students to Camarillo Shotokan. 

In 1995, Senpai Daniel earned his 1st Degree black belt.  He also pursued other activities, including high school wrestling where he reigned Mira Monte League wrestling champion. He also earned the rank of Eagle Scout.  In 1999, the Boys and Girls Club was interested in starting a karate program at their facility and Senpai Daniel was sent to teach there.  In 2001, Senpai Daniel passed his 2nd Degree black belt exam. 

Daniel took a 5 year hiatus from Shotokan to concentrate on his college education. He did however manage to sneak in some training at a Shito Ryu dojo near campus.  During that time, he earned a BS in Electrical Engineering, a BS in Computer Science and a MS in Engineering Management.  He is currently employed by the U.S. Navy as a Software Engineer. 

Senpai Daniel is the eldest of four brothers – three are black belts and one is a brown belt!
